Transaction 307234ffb3036faee3e8b26757f6057cd4a8d34d3a062605159925d27a4ae8a8

1 Input
2 Outputs
  • 307234ffb3036faee3e8b26757f6057cd4a8d34d3a062605159925d27a4ae8a8:0
  • value  228300
    address  14dshH7i3DVkXJwNNpr1G6FR7VQEzP3XsY
  • 307234ffb3036faee3e8b26757f6057cd4a8d34d3a062605159925d27a4ae8a8:1
  • value  1103444
    address  1CVA6VWnXK4JTBegE41hk6WEstmJg6v4xr